Good observance: Pig does seem to use a default "false" when possible, to disable the _SUCCESS creation. I don't see Hive do that, nor any part of the stock Apache Hadoop MR jobs.
Rahul - Do you use a Pig action in your WF? Also, are you definitively seeing _SUCCESS being created after you add the option manually?
